What Advantages Come with a GPS on an e-bike?
In different places, theft of e-bikes is a major issue. Since they are lighter and smaller, e-bikes are easily taken, compared to cars that usually feature advanced alarms. When e-bikes are, in many cases, broken down and sold for parts, it can be very complex to save them. With a GPS tracker, it becomes easier to stop theft and recover the stolen e-bike.
In this situation, the owner will receive a warning right away if someone moves the e-Bike against their will. Getting real-time updates on a mobile location makes it possible for authorities to act fast and increase the chances of finding the device. In addition, some high-end trackers allow you to disable the e-Bike’s engine from a distance, so that, even if thieves open the lock, they can’t ride it.

Important Elements to Consider in a GPS Tracker
Your needs should help you choose a good GPS tracker, but particular features always matter. Here are the leading aspects to look for:
- The main function keeps you informed about your e-Bike’s location at all times. Try to choose trackers that give up-to-date and precise location information.
- With these capabilities, you can set a geofence and get an alert as soon as your e-Bike is inside or outside these set zones.
- Tracking on the go should be easy, thanks to a practical interface on both the app and web portal. Check that your smartphone and the device are compatible and ensure the device is easy to use.
- If you have a fleet or want to update your parents, watch the e-Bike’s speed and also review its ride history.
- Depending on the model, biking trackers are powered by their battery or by the e-bike’s electricity. Even if the e-Bike’s power is lost, devices with a built-in battery keep running.
- If you try to take out or disable the tracker, the system will immediately tell you.
- Featured on top models, the remote engine immobilizer enables an unauthorized user to be locked out of the e-Bike from far away.
- During an accident, some trackers instantly contact your emergency contacts and let them know where you are, which might save your life.

Considering privacy and the rules of law
Even though GPS tracking is very beneficial, it’s important to think about privacy and the rules set by lawmakers. Most countries allow you to install a tracker on the vehicles you use or own. You may violate the privacy laws if you use it to track someone unknowingly. Businesses and parents need to tell their passengers that the e-bike is being watched by a monitoring service.
